1️⃣ 🧠 What Is Agnosticism at Its Core ❓


Agnosticism is not a belief system about God’s existence; it is a position about human knowledge. It holds that ultimate reality, especially concerning the divine, is unknown or unknowable with current human faculties.




2️⃣ 📜 The Origin of the Term Agnosticism


The term was coined by Thomas Henry Huxley in the 19th century. It comes from the Greek a-gnosis, meaning “without knowledge.” This highlights epistemology, not theology.




3️⃣ 🔍 Agnosticism Is About Knowledge, Not Faith


Agnosticism does not say “God does not exist” nor “God exists.”
It says:
👉 “I do not know, and I may not be able to know.”




4️⃣ ⚖️ Agnosticism vs Atheism vs Theism


  • Theism: God exists
  • Atheism: God does not exist
  • Agnosticism: The truth is uncertain or inaccessible

Agnosticism occupies the epistemic middle ground.




5️⃣ 🧩 Is Agnosticism Neutral ❓


Yes, but not passive.
Agnosticism is intellectually active neutrality—it questions, investigates, and withholds final judgment without denial or affirmation.




6️⃣ 🧠 The Epistemological Foundation


Agnosticism rests on the limits of:


  • Human perception
  • Reason
  • Language
  • Empirical verification

It asserts that some truths may lie beyond human cognition.




7️⃣ 🌍 Agnosticism as a Worldview


As a worldview, agnosticism promotes:


  • Intellectual humility
  • Openness to dialogue
  • Resistance to dogma

It values process over conclusions.




8️⃣ 🧘 Psychological Dimension of Agnosticism


Psychologically, agnosticism:


  • Reduces existential pressure
  • Encourages tolerance of ambiguity
  • Supports mental flexibility

Not knowing becomes a stable state, not a failure.




9️⃣ 📖 Moral Framework Without Certainty


Agnosticism does not reject morality.
Ethics are often grounded in:


  • Human well-being
  • Empathy
  • Reason
  • Shared experience

Morality is constructed, not divinely asserted.




🔟 🌐 Social and Cultural Implications


Agnostic worldviews tend to support:


  • Pluralism
  • Freedom of belief
  • Respect for differences

Because certainty is suspended, coexistence becomes essential.




1️⃣1️⃣ 🧠 Agnosticism and Science


Agnosticism aligns naturally with science:


  • Accepts uncertainty
  • Revises beliefs with evidence
  • Rejects absolute claims without proof

Truth is provisional, not final.




1️⃣2️⃣ 🔄 Is Agnosticism a Temporary Position ❓


For some, yes. For others, it is permanent.
Agnosticism allows evolution of thought without forcing closure.




1️⃣3️⃣ 🌌 Spirituality Without Dogma


Many agnostics are not anti-spiritual.
They may experience:


  • Awe
  • Meaning
  • Transcendence

Without defining these experiences as divine facts.




1️⃣4️⃣ ⚠️ Common Misunderstandings


Agnosticism is often mistaken for:


  • Indecision ❌
  • Indifference ❌
  • Weak belief ❌

In reality, it is disciplined intellectual restraint.




1️⃣5️⃣ 🧭 Existential Responsibility


Without absolute answers, responsibility shifts to the individual:


  • Meaning is created, not received
  • Purpose is chosen, not dictated

This can be liberating or challenging.




1️⃣6️⃣ 🌱 Growth Through Uncertainty


Agnosticism sees uncertainty not as a void, but as:


  • A space for learning
  • A catalyst for humility
  • A guard against fanaticism



1️⃣7️⃣ 🕊️ Tolerance as a Core Value


Because no ultimate claim is finalized, agnosticism fosters:


  • Dialogue over domination
  • Listening over preaching
  • Curiosity over judgment



1️⃣8️⃣ 🧩 Deep Summary of the Worldview


🧠 The agnostic worldview holds that:


Human knowledge has limits, ultimate truths may be inaccessible, and intellectual humility is a virtue rather than a weakness.

Agnosticism is a worldview that holds the belief that the existence or non-existence of a higher power or gods is ultimately unknown or unknowable. Agnostics are unsure or skeptical about the existence of a higher being and often believe that there is not enough evidence to prove or disprove the existence of God or gods. They do not claim to have definitive knowledge about the existence of a higher power and remain open to the possibility of its existence but refrain from asserting any specific beliefs. Agnostics approach religious and philosophical questions with agnosticism as their guiding principle, emphasizing the importance of critical thinking, skepticism, and the acceptance of uncertainty in matters of faith and spirituality.

Agnosticism is a philosophical position that states that the existence of God or gods is unknown and unknowable. It is a stance of intellectual humility, uncertainty, and skepticism towards claims about the divine. Agnosticism does not assert the existence or non-existence of God, but rather emphasizes that the answer to this question is beyond human knowledge or comprehension. Therefore, the worldview of agnosticism is characterized by openness to multiple possibilities and a focus on empirical evidence rather than religious or metaphysical assertions.

Agnosticism is a philosophical viewpoint that holds that the existence of God or any other deity or supernatural being cannot be proven or disproven through objective means. While agnostics do not deny the possibility of the existence of some form of higher power or divine force, they also do not believe in the ability of humans to understand or comprehend the concept of such an entity.

At its core, agnosticism is a worldview that emphasizes tolerance, open-mindedness, and humility. Agnostics do not claim to have all the answers, and recognize that there are limits to human knowledge and understanding. Instead of clinging dogmatically to one set of beliefs or another, agnostics take a more nuanced, reflective approach to examining the world around them.

Because agnosticism is not a belief system in the traditional sense, it can take on a variety of different forms and manifestations. Some agnostics may be skeptical of the idea of an all-knowing, all-powerful deity, while others may simply believe that it is impossible for humans to grasp the concept of God. Still others may reject organized religion as a cultural construct, but remain open to the possibility of a spiritual dimension to life.

Despite the diversity of beliefs among agnostics, there is a common thread that runs through the worldview. This thread is the recognition that the world is complex and mysterious, and that human understanding is limited. Rather than trying to impose simplistic explanations on complex phenomena, agnostics approach the world with a sense of wonder, curiosity, and humility.

In the end, agnosticism is a worldview that emphasizes the importance of remaining open to new ideas and perspectives. It is a reminder that there is always more to learn, more to explore, and more to discover about the world we live in. By embracing the uncertainty and mystery of existence, agnostics can cultivate a deeper sense of appreciation for the beauty and complexity of life.
